Calling and Video Features on ‘X’
Leaders Online Desk: Elon Musk has announced today (August 31) that social media platform ‘X’ (formerly Twitter) will soon introduce audio-video calling feature. In this feature, users can make audio-video calls without sharing the number. Company owner Elon Musk has given this information by posting on ‘X’. Earlier, the CEO of the company, Linda Yacarino, confirmed this in an interview given to the news channel CNBC (Video & audio calls on ‘X’).
Billionaire entrepreneur Elon Musk has made a number of changes since he took over the reins of Twitter last year. The biggest change Musk has made is changing the name of the social media platform. He has changed the name of ‘Twitter’ to ‘X’. Now Elon Musk’s platform ‘X’ is all set to compete single-handedly with all of Meta’s platforms. Similarly, Musk has made a big announcement that X is bringing audio-video calling feature on this platform (Video & audio calls on ‘X’).
Users will now be able to make video and audio calls on social media platform ‘X’ like WhatsApp, Instagram and Facebook thanks to the announcement of a new feature by Elon Musk. In a post made by Musk in this regard, it has been said that this new feature on ‘X’ will be available to all types of phone and laptop users. This feature will be easily available in Android, iOS and Laptop. At the same time, it is not necessary to know someone’s phone number for video and audio calls. Even without knowing the number, people will be able to talk to each other through X, Musk has made it clear in the post (Video & audio calls on ‘X’).
